Five Tibetan Rites – What Is It?

The practice known as the Five Tibetan Rites is over 2,500 years old. Tibetan monks believed that the aging process could be effectively slowed down by certain practices. They developed the rites, which condensed 21 yoga practices into five exercises. The exercises basically address the seven chakras learned from yoga. These energy centres are related to the endocrine system. Aging is hormone-based, so these exercises are aimed at hormonal balance.
